Chrysler Early Hemi 8x2 Log Manifold – Eight-Deuce Intake (1951–1958)
Nothing defines early drag racing like an eight-deuce log manifold.
This two-piece cast aluminum intake is a true “log” style manifold inspired by the U-Fab intakes of the 1950s.
Each set includes left and right manifolds with fully machined carburetor bases, allowing all eight two-barrel carburetors to face the same direction for a clean, uniform engine bay layout.
Whether you're building a nostalgia drag car, traditional show rod, or period-correct gasser, this intake brings unmistakable early Hemi presence.
Engine Fitment
Fits 1951–1958 Chrysler and Dodge:
- 331 Hemi
- 354 Hemi
- 392 Hemi
- Works with unique combinations such as 392 heads on low-deck (331–354) blocks
Carburetor Compatibility
Accepts:
- Stromberg 48
- Stromberg 81
- Stromberg 97
- Holley 94 two-barrel carburetors
Drilled for both driver and passenger carb patterns.
Key Features
- True 1950s “log” style intake design
- Two-piece casting (left and right)
- Fully machined gasket sealing surfaces
- Machined carburetor bases for consistent alignment
- Shot-peened matte finish (polishing optional)
- 356 heat-treated cast aluminum
- Total weight: 17 lbs
- Sold as a matched pair
What’s Included
- (1) Passenger side log manifold
- (1) Driver side log manifold
- (16) 3/8-16 x 1" stainless button head bolts
- (2) Equalizer hoses

Frequently Asked Questions
Is this a tunnel ram?
No. This is a true log-style intake manifold patterned after 1950s U-Fab designs.
Are carburetors included?
No. Carburetors are not included.
Do all eight carburetors face the same direction?
Yes. Each manifold is machined so all carburetors face the same direction for a clean layout.
Is this cast or billet?
This manifold is cast from 356 heat-treated aluminum for authentic period texture and strength.
